SA20 third edition dates suggest great pains to avoid clash with Proteas' interests

SA20 league commissioner Graeme Smith announced the dates for the third edition of South Africa's T20 tournament on Friday, and it appears that every effort has been made to avoid another disastrous clash with the Proteas' international engagements in the summer. The SA20 tournament has been hugely successful in reviving public interest at grounds around the country with top international players on its books as it looks to inject much-needed cash into the domestic cricket scene.
